The cheapest way to get from Alicante to La Isleta del Moro is to bus which costs €28 - €40 and takes 6h 28m.
The fastest way to get from Alicante to La Isleta del Moro is to drive which takes 2h 59m and costs €40 - €65.
No, there is no direct bus from Alicante to La Isleta del Moro. However, there are services departing from Estación de Autobuses de Alicante/Alacant and arriving at La Isleta del Moro via Almería.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 28m.
The distance between Alicante and La Isleta del Moro is 278 km. The road distance is 276.2 km.
The best way to get from Alicante to La Isleta del Moro without a car is to bus which takes 6h 28m and costs €28 - €40.
It takes approximately 4h 54m to get from Alicante to La Isleta del Moro, including transfers.
Alicante to La Isleta del Moro bus services, operated by ALSA, depart from Estación de Autobuses de Alicante/Alacant station.
Alicante to La Isleta del Moro bus services, operated by ALSA, arrive at Almeria station.
Yes, the driving distance between Alicante to La Isleta del Moro is 276 km. It takes approximately 2h 59m to drive from Alicante to La Isleta del Moro.
